Output d70f3ef4ee71a824f453d69e44f2e700a47c1772c2fe908b81aa1d24b2cde542:0

value
20740606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b30c94d8f8c77970b3335db3f58f63a199e4c9a OP_EQUAL
address
375zEbXPyAeX8zHa1kKZq5JU2budrnQxu6
transaction
d70f3ef4ee71a824f453d69e44f2e700a47c1772c2fe908b81aa1d24b2cde542
spent
true